Output d1f8c462dc17d27874e79c62825d93345ab6924cd6b2c4de6bd78dcd2b24a945:15

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84146fcce69e4c4f9faabab42edfa4b1f0f6833d OP_EQUAL
address
3DjPbqJSo2Lgqe42axvoCAQqd6a62QCo5v
transaction
d1f8c462dc17d27874e79c62825d93345ab6924cd6b2c4de6bd78dcd2b24a945
confirmations
173129
spent
true